    I just right clicked on the coupon, then 'save picture as'.
    Saved it to the desktop, then opened a blank 'word' document, and dragged the coupon(s) onto it (adjusted it to just under quarter page size).

    The print out seems clear enough, and I'll be trying it on saturday to see if it scans ok.
